Knowledge in the closing process but as well knowledge about Income statement, Balance sheet, Cash flow and R&D capitalization/amortization is strength Within GTT Controlling and Strategy, Range and Project Control supports Truck Product Projects in managing financials of the project portfolio. The team is in charge of driving the profitability analysis and the financial controlling of individual projects and of the range portfolio. The Department is also supporting the GTT project budget and forecast process (project view) in close connection to GTT Product Planning.

The position of Senior Controller R&D and Allocation is an exciting and challenging position monitoring the controlling of the R&D portfolio and the allocation of R&D to the Brands.

This position is a member of the R&PC management team supporting the allocation of R&D to the brands and the products. The position holder will also support the analysis and consolidation of the financial view of the GTT R&D portfolio.

The position holder works closely with a large network of stakeholders: GTT Finance Governance, GTT Product Planning, Product Ranges, the Business Control of the Brands, AB Volvo Business Control and all other functions involved in the analysis and reporting of the R&D portfolio.

The position holder has the responsibility to secure compliance with GTT and Volvo Group financial policies when it comes to allocations of R&D.
